Pure titanium plate represents a remarkable advancement in material science, offering an exceptional combination of strength, durability, and versatility. This high-performance material features a unique molecular structure that provides superior resistance to corrosion, making it ideal for diverse applications across multiple industries. The plate's composition consists of 99.2% pure titanium, ensuring maximum performance and reliability. With a tensile strength ranging from 240 to 550 MPa and density of 4.51 g/cm3, these plates demonstrate remarkable mechanical properties while maintaining relatively light weight. The manufacturing process involves advanced metallurgical techniques, including vacuum arc remelting and precise temperature control, resulting in a uniform microstructure that enhances overall performance. Pure titanium plates are available in various thicknesses, typically ranging from 0.5mm to 50mm, accommodating different application requirements. Their exceptional biocompatibility makes them particularly valuable in medical applications, while their resistance to extreme temperatures and chemical environments makes them essential in aerospace and chemical processing industries. The plates feature excellent heat transfer properties and maintain structural integrity under varying temperature conditions, from cryogenic to elevated temperatures up to 600°C. Additionally, their natural oxide layer formation provides self-healing properties, ensuring long-term durability and minimal maintenance requirements.

Pure titanium plates offer numerous compelling advantages that make them an optimal choice for various applications. First and foremost, their exceptional strength-to-weight ratio sets them apart from conventional materials, providing robust structural integrity while maintaining lightweight characteristics. This unique combination results in reduced overall system weight without compromising performance. The material's outstanding corrosion resistance eliminates the need for additional protective coatings, leading to significant cost savings in long-term maintenance. The plates exhibit remarkable thermal stability, maintaining their mechanical properties across a wide temperature range, which makes them ideal for demanding environmental conditions. Their biocompatibility and non-toxic nature make them perfect for medical implants and food processing equipment. The material's high fatigue strength ensures extended service life, reducing replacement frequency and associated costs. Pure titanium plates also demonstrate excellent weldability and fabrication characteristics, allowing for versatile manufacturing processes and complex designs. Their non-magnetic properties make them suitable for applications where electromagnetic interference must be avoided. The plates' low thermal expansion coefficient ensures dimensional stability during temperature fluctuations, critical for precision applications. Additionally, their ability to withstand aggressive chemical environments makes them invaluable in chemical processing and marine applications. The material's natural oxide layer provides self-healing properties, ensuring continued protection against corrosion and environmental factors. Their excellent heat distribution properties make them ideal for heat exchangers and thermal management systems.

Superior Corrosion Resistance

Pure titanium plates excel in corrosion resistance due to their unique ability to form a stable, self-repairing oxide layer. This natural protective barrier, primarily composed of titanium dioxide, forms spontaneously when exposed to oxygen and provides exceptional protection against various corrosive environments. The oxide layer is remarkably stable in most atmospheric conditions, acids, chlorides, and other aggressive chemical environments. This inherent resistance eliminates the need for additional protective coatings or treatments, reducing both initial and maintenance costs. The corrosion resistance remains effective across a wide pH range, from 3 to 11, making these plates suitable for diverse chemical processing applications. Even if the surface becomes scratched or damaged, the oxide layer quickly regenerates, maintaining continuous protection. This self-healing capability ensures long-term reliability and minimal maintenance requirements throughout the product's lifecycle.

Exceptional Mechanical Properties

The mechanical properties of pure titanium plates represent a perfect balance between strength and practicality. These plates exhibit remarkable tensile strength while maintaining excellent ductility, allowing for complex forming operations without compromising structural integrity. The material's high strength-to-weight ratio surpasses many conventional metals, enabling weight reduction in structural applications without sacrificing performance. The plates demonstrate superior fatigue resistance, maintaining their mechanical properties even under cyclic loading conditions. Their excellent impact resistance and toughness make them ideal for applications requiring durability under dynamic loads. The material's unique crystal structure contributes to its exceptional mechanical stability across a wide temperature range, ensuring consistent performance in varying environmental conditions. These properties combine to create a versatile material that meets the demanding requirements of aerospace, medical, and industrial applications.

Versatile Processing Capabilities

Pure titanium plates offer remarkable processing versatility, accommodating various manufacturing methods and finishing techniques. The material exhibits excellent formability, allowing for both cold and hot forming processes without compromising its mechanical properties. Its superior weldability enables various joining techniques, including TIG welding, electron beam welding, and laser welding, resulting in high-quality, durable connections. The plates can be machined using conventional methods, though specific cutting parameters and tooling considerations are necessary to achieve optimal results. Surface finishing options range from mechanical polishing to chemical treatments, enabling customization for specific application requirements. The material's ability to maintain dimensional stability during processing ensures precise manufacturing tolerances. Advanced processing techniques such as superplastic forming can be employed for complex geometries, expanding design possibilities. These processing capabilities, combined with the material's inherent properties, make pure titanium plates adaptable to diverse manufacturing requirements and end-use applications.
